1
Fork 0
mirror of https://https.git.savannah.gnu.org/git/guix.git/ synced 2025-07-14 19:10:49 +02:00
Commit graph

6675 commits

Author SHA1 Message Date
Liliana Marie Prikler
267a4c4403
gnu: emacs-meson-mode: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-meson-mode)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:08 +02:00
Liliana Marie Prikler
6888282526
gnu: emacs-quickrun: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-quickrun)[arguments]: Add #:test-command.
[native-inputs]: Add python-wrapper.
2025-06-15 16:57:08 +02:00
Liliana Marie Prikler
087ba745bc
gnu: emacs-log4e: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-log4e)[arguments]: Add #:tests? #f.
2025-06-15 16:57:08 +02:00
Liliana Marie Prikler
a639ed8d9f
gnu: emacs-org-ref: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-org-ref)[#:phases]: Add
‘skip-failing-test’.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:08 +02:00
Liliana Marie Prikler
cb25c2898d
gnu: emacs-org-roam: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-org-roam)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:08 +02:00
Liliana Marie Prikler
cd3013c2cf
gnu: emacs-ov: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-ov)[arguments]: Add #:test-command.
<#:phases>: Add ‘skip-failing-tests’.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:08 +02:00
Liliana Marie Prikler
43cf700cd4
gnu: emacs-helm-lsp: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-helm-lsp)[arguments]: Add #:tests? #f.
2025-06-15 16:57:08 +02:00
Liliana Marie Prikler
524af2798b
gnu: emacs-flycheck-rust: Add missing test inputs.
* gnu/packages/emacs-xyz.scm (emacs-flycheck-rust)[native-inputs]: Add
emacs-buttercup, rust-boostrap and rust-boostrap:cargo.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
09b473dce9
gnu: emacs-lsp-mode: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-lsp-mode)[arguments]: Add #:test-command.
<#:phases>: Add ‘skip-failing-tests’ and ‘set-home’.
[native-inputs]: Add emacs-deferred, emacs-el-mock, and emacs-ert-runner.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
5f10194518
gnu: emacs-hl-todo: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-hl-todo)[arguments]: Add #:tests? #f.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
e99b5fc0a5
gnu: emacs-image+: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-image+)[arguments]: Add #:test-command.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
1cd7e27ac8
gnu: emacs-ivy-omni-org: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-ivy-omni-org)[arguments]: Add #:tests? #f.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
6364319bd9
gnu: emacs-global-tags: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-global-tags)[source]: Add requirement for
eieio.
[arguments]: Add #:tests? #f.
[native-inputs]: Add emacs-buttercup and emacs-f.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
93951eaac9
gnu: emacs-interactive-align: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-interactive-align)[arguments]:
Add #:tests? #f.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
ec3d9007d8
gnu: emacs-hsluv: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-hsluv)[arguments]: Add #:test-command.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
934e7173c6
gnu: emacs-gitlab-ci-mode: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-gitlab-ci-mode)[arguments]:
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:07 +02:00
Liliana Marie Prikler
ed6918f770
gnu: emacs-helm-flycheck: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-helm-flycheck)[arguments]: Add #:tests? #f.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
8b762e556b
gnu: emacs-jabber: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-jabber)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
c055953fa2
gnu: emacs-fountain-mode: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-fountain-mode)[arguments]: Add #:tests? #f.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
9d8be82876
gnu: emacs-lispyville: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-lispyville)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
58d98809f8
gnu: emacs-gnuplot: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-gnuplot)[arguments]: Add #:test-command
and #:phases.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
744dc903ae
gnu: emacs-flycheck-package: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-flycheck-package)[arguments]:
Add #:tests? #f.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
1f8037fef6
gnu: emacs-helm-swoop: Add missing test inputs.
* gnu/packages/emacs-xyz.scm (emacs-helm-swoop)[native-inputs]: Add
emacs-buttercup.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
664fb41608
gnu: emacs-hcl-mode: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-hcl-mode)[arguments]: Add #:test-command.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
9dda9bb4c9
gnu: emacs-interleave: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-interleave)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ecukes.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
df26be554e
gnu: emacs-inheritenv: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-inheritenv)[arguments]: Add #:test-command.
2025-06-15 16:57:06 +02:00
Liliana Marie Prikler
be6335f2da
gnu: emacs-helm-linux-disks: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-helm-linux-disks)[arguments]:
Add #:tests? #f.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
86f6e8af4f
gnu: emacs-elpher: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-elpher)[arguments]: Add #:tests? #f.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
3503a4d03b
gnu: emacs-ibuffer-vc: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-ibuffer-vc)[arguments]: Add #:tests? #f.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
fea6d68e13
gnu: emacs-jupyter: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-jupyter)[arguments]: Add #:tests? #f.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
450c3037ad
gnu: emacs-git-gutter-fringe: Skip tests.
* gnu/packages/emacs-xyz.scm (emacs-git-gutter-fringe)[arguments]:
Add #:tests? #f.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
10a3e44b31
gnu: emacs-package-lint: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-package-lint)[arguments]:
Add #:test-command.  Disable tests.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
c5e0e534d5
gnu: emacs-back-button: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-back-button)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
f64542a36e
gnu: emacs-flim-lb: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-flim-lb)[#:phases]: Add ‘set-home’.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
37fb31685e
gnu: emacs-bind-map: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-bind-map)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-evil.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
add769730d
gnu: emacs-edn: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-edn)[arguments]: Add #:test-command.
Disable tests.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
01c73fff16
gnu: emacs-frames-only-mode: Add missing test inputs.
* gnu/packages/emacs-xyz.scm (emacs-frames-only-mode)[native-inputs]: Add
emacs-ert-runner, emacs-flycheck, and emacs-magit.
2025-06-15 16:57:05 +02:00
Liliana Marie Prikler
bac3bdbcab
gnu: emacs-evil-numbers: Skip failing t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-numbers)[#:phases]: Add
‘skip-failing-tests’.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
a85bc929b8
gnu: emacs-eacl: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-eacl)[arguments]: Add #:test-command.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
35f28c84a2
gnu: emacs-e2wm: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-e2wm)[arguments]: Add #:test-command.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
465257bf3c
gnu: emacs-editorconfig: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-editorconfig)[arguments]:
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
30aeb92eea
gnu: emacs-google-translate: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-google-translate)[#:phases]:
Add ‘disable-failing-tests’.
[native-inputs]: Add emacs-el-mock and emacs-ert-runner.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
3ea11b69dd
gnu: emacs-evil-mc: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-mc)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ecukes, emacs-evil-numbers, and emacs-evil-surround.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
9d19a2c177
gnu: emacs-daemons: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-daemons)[arguments]: Add #:test-command
and ‘skip-failing-tests’ phase.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
283f7b133b
gnu: emacs-beginend: Add missing test inputs.
* gnu/packages/emacs-xyz.scm (emacs-beginend)[native-inputs]: Add
emacs-assess, emacs-buttercup, emacs-ert-runner, and emacs-undercover.
[inputs]: Remove emacs-undercover.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
e2e5ab3826
gnu: Add emacs-assess.
* gnu/packages/emacs-xyz.scm (emacs-assess): New variable.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
cd15bc04db
gnu: emacs-m-buffer-el: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-m-buffer-el)[arguments]: Add #:test-command.
Remove unnecessary check phase.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
d0c46fc4f5
gnu: emacs-helm-gtags: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-helm-gtags)[arguments]: Add #:test-command.
[native-inputs]: Add emacs-ert-runner.
2025-06-15 16:57:04 +02:00
Liliana Marie Prikler
60763e92c2
gnu: emacs-evil-smartparens: Handle t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-smartparens)[arguments]:
Add #:test-command.  Disable tests.
[native-inputs]: Add emacs-evil-surround.
2025-06-15 16:57:03 +02:00
Liliana Marie Prikler
8617b88fc8
gnu: emacs-evil-matchit: Fix tests.
* gnu/packages/emacs-xyz.scm (emacs-evil-matchit)[arguments]:
Add #:test-command.
<#:phases>: Add ‘patch-Makefile’.
[native-inputs]: Add emacs-lua-mode, emacs-markdown-mode, emacs-tuareg,
and emacs-yaml-mode.
2025-06-15 16:57:03 +02:00